Quick Answer
Ryerson Holding Corp reported Revenue (ASC 606) of $4.57 billion for fiscal year 2025.
Ryerson Holding Corp Revenue (ASC 606) — Annual History
| Fiscal Year | Revenue (ASC 606) |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$4.57B | -0.6% |
| 2024 | $4.60B | -10.0% |
| 2023 | $5.11B | -19.2% |
| 2022 | $6.32B | +11.4% |
| 2021 | $5.68B | +63.7% |
| 2020 | $3.47B | -23.0% |
| 2019 | $4.50B | +2.1% |
| 2018 | $4.41B | +31.0% |
| 2017 | $3.36B | +17.7% |
| 2016 | $2.86B | — |

- Ryerson Holding Corp showed a decrease of -0.6% in Revenue (ASC 606) compared to the prior fiscal year.
- Over the 2016–2025 period, Ryerson Holding Corp’s revenue (asc 606) has grown by 59.9% (from $2.86 billion to $4.57 billion).
- The most recent figure is from Ryerson Holding Corp’s fiscal year 2025 report (Form 10-K), filed with the SEC on February 23, 2026.
